The American IronHorse Texas Chopper Base was a v2, four-stroke standard produced by American IronHorse between 2007 and 2010.

Engine

The engine was a air cooled v2, four-stroke. Fuel was supplied via a overhead valves (ohv).

Drive

The bike has a 6-speed transmission. Power was moderated via the chrome hydraulic ´easy pull´.

Chassis

It came with a 90/90-r21 front tire and a 300/40-v18 rear tire. Stopping was achieved via single disc. 4-piston polished calipers in the front and a single disc. 4-piston polished calipers in the rear. The front suspension was a telescopic fork while the rear was equipped with a twin sided swing arm. The Texas Chopper Base was fitted with a 3.43 Gallon (13.00 Liters) fuel tank. The bike weighed just 698.87 pounds (317.0 Kg). The wheelbase was 84.02 inches (2134 mm) long.
